Hundreds Of Students Pack Football Showcase, Ignore Social Distancing
The organizer says it was worth it for the sake of the kids' future and sanity.
CHICAGO (CBS) — Hundreds of students from around the Chicago area went to Naperville for a football showcase with no social distancing and barely any masks. The organizer says it was worth it for the sake of the kids’ future and sanity.
Video on social media shows a fun time. High school and middle school students packed at football field at Commissioners Park in Naperville for drills. It would be an OK sight if it weren’t for the COVID-19 pandemic and community complaints that followed.
